Output 73bbeda756ec32f03eecd89eb28f5c84efa9d31c097239435e6ea7ae0aba9542:17

value
772545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02923e00f13b18b246dc3e14ae8aeaf04a9518c0 OP_EQUAL
address
31vcU1kTuWhJ7MRycPdUqJhQ78PBknv5VH
transaction
73bbeda756ec32f03eecd89eb28f5c84efa9d31c097239435e6ea7ae0aba9542
spent
true